Amblyseius-System & Amblyseius-Breeding-System

Amblyseius-System & Amblyseius-Breeding-System

Voracious predators target thrips

  • Highly voracious – predatory mites feed on thrips larvae
  • Very mobile – predatory mites seek out prey
  • Can be used preventativelyA. cucumeris can survive without prey, feeding on pollen or Nutrimite
  • Generalist predator – can also feed on spider mite and other small mites. 

Why are breeding sachets so effective?

  • Sachets contain food – bran carrier and factitious prey - for the predatory mites
  • A. cucumeris mites multiply inside the sachets
  • Continual release of predatory mites over several weeks.
